Passenger Compartment Fuse Box (Fuse Panel C -SC-)
This fuse box, also known as Fuse Panel C or SC, houses fuses for various interior components.
Location
- Left-Hand Drive (LHD): Located behind a cover on the driver’s side of the dashboard.
- Right-Hand Drive (RHD): Located behind the storage compartment on the front passenger side.

Key Fuse Assignments:
- SC1 (30A): Control unit for reducing agent heater (diesel models)
- SC7 (10A): Climate control, heated rear window, tire pressure monitoring
- SC11 (25A/40A): Front left headlight, seatbelt tensioner
- SC23 (40A/20A): Front right headlight, sunroof
- SC33 (5A/7.5A): Airbag control unit
- SC40 (20A): Cigarette lighter and 12V power sockets
Engine Compartment Fuse Box (Fuse Panels B -SB- & A -SA-)
This compartment houses two fuse panels: B (SB) and A (SA), responsible for engine-related components.
Location
Located on the left side of the engine compartment, near the battery.

Key Fuse Assignments:
- SB1 (25A/40A): ABS control unit
- SB3 (15A/30A): Engine control unit
- SB10 (20A/10A/15A): Fuel pump control unit
- SB14 (40A/30A): Heated windscreen relay
- SB23 (30A): Starter
- SA1 (125A/80A): Power supply for various components including fuse holder C

Understanding Your Fuse Box
Fuse boxes are critical components of your vehicle’s electrical system. Consult your owner’s manual for specific fuse ratings and assignments for your 2017 Passat model. Always replace a blown fuse with one of the same amperage rating. If a new fuse blows quickly, it indicates a more serious electrical problem that requires professional diagnosis.
